Kim Ji-won (Korean: 김지원; born October 19, 1992) is a South Korean actress.She gained attention through her roles in television series The Heirs (2013) and Descendants of the Sun (2016), before taking on leading roles in Fight for My Way (2017), Arthdal Chronicles (2019), Lovestruck in the City (2020–2021), My Liberation Notes (2022) and Queen of Tears (2024).

  2. Kim Ji-min ( Korean : 김지민; Hanja : 金智珉; [1] born November 30, 1984) is a South Korean comedian, television host, and actress. She debuted as a comedian on the sketch-comedy show Gag Concert in 2006.

  3. Run On (Korean: 런 온; RR: Reon on) is a 2020 South Korean television series starring Im Si-wan, Shin Se-kyung, Choi Soo-young, and Kang Tae-oh. It aired on JTBC from December 16, 2020, to February 4, 2021, and is available for streaming worldwide on Netflix.

    Kim Ji-eun ( Korean : 김지은; born October 9, 1993) is a South Korean actress. She is best known for appearances in the television series The Veil (2021), Again My Life (2022), and One Dollar Lawyer (2022). Early life. Kim Ji-eun was born in Incheon, South Korea on October 9, 1993.

  5. Crazy Rich Asians is a 2018 American romantic comedy-drama film directed by Jon M. Chu, from a screenplay by Peter Chiarelli and Adele Lim, based on the 2013 novel of the same title by Kevin Kwan. The film stars Constance Wu, Henry Golding, Gemma Chan, Lisa Lu, Awkwafina, Ken Jeong, and Michelle Yeoh.

    Kim Soo-hyun ( Korean : 김수현; born February 16, 1988) is a South Korean actor. One of the highest-paid actors in South Korea in 2020, [3] his accolades include five Baeksang Arts Awards, two Grand Bell Awards and one Blue Dragon Film Award. From 2012 to 2016, in 2021 and 2022, he has appeared in Forbes Korea Power Celebrity 40 list. [4] .

  7. Jin Zhi-Juan ( Chinese: 金智娟; pinyin: Jīn Zhìjuān; born 4 October 1964) is a Taiwanese singer-songwriter, formerly known by the stage-name Wawa (娃娃 "Doll"). [1] [2] She achieved first success as the singer with the 4-man pop band Qiuqiu Chorus ( zh:丘丘合唱團 ).
